/**********************************************************************
TE7750 Super I/O Expander
by Tokyo Electron Device Ltd. (TEL)
The TE7750 and its successors are CMOS I/O expanders equipped with
nine 8-bit parallel ports, which can programmed for input or
output either in hardware or in software.
In soft mode (IOS2-0 = 0), control registers CR1, CR2 and CR3 to
set P1, P3, P4, P6, P7, P9 for byte input or output and P20-23,
P24-27, P50-53, P54-57 for separate nibble input or output. All
ports are set for input upon reset.
In hard mode, the state of the IOS pins upon reset determines
how many of P2, P3, P4, P5, P6 and P7 are set for output. P1 is
always set for input and P9 is always set for output. CR1-CR3 are
not used and separate nibble I/O is not available.
CR0 determines the direction of each bit of P8 in both modes.
The MS pin is offered for dual bus compatibility. When MS is 0,
RD and WR need to be brought active low separately. When MS is 1,
RD becomes a Motorola-style R/W control signal (R = 1, W = 0),
and WR becomes an active-low "M Enable" input.
TE7750, TE7751, TE7753 and TE7754 appear to be functionally
almost identical, though only the last two are pin-compatible.
One known difference is that TE7753 resets all output latches to
"H" and TE7754 resets them to "L" (the latches can be written in
soft mode before the ports are set for output). TE7750 and TE7751
probably do either one or the other, but available documentation
is incomplete.
***********************************************************************
A3 A2 A1 A0 Register D7 D6 D5 D4 D3 D2 D1 D0
----------- -------- -- -- -- -- -- -- -- --
0 0 0 0 Port 1 R/W R/W R/W R/W R/W R/W R/W R/W
0 0 0 1 Port 2 R/W R/W R/W R/W R/W R/W R/W R/W
0 0 1 0 Port 3 R/W R/W R/W R/W R/W R/W R/W R/W
0 0 1 1 Port 4 R/W R/W R/W R/W R/W R/W R/W R/W
0 1 0 0 Port 5 R/W R/W R/W R/W R/W R/W R/W R/W
0 1 0 1 Port 6 R/W R/W R/W R/W R/W R/W R/W R/W
0 1 1 0 Port 7 R/W R/W R/W R/W R/W R/W R/W R/W
0 1 1 1 Port 8 R/W R/W R/W R/W R/W R/W R/W R/W
1 0 0 0 Port 9 R/W R/W R/W R/W R/W R/W R/W R/W
1 0 0 1 CR0 W W W W W W W W
1 0 1 0 CR1 W* W* W* W*
1 0 1 1 CR2 W* W* W* W*
1 1 0 0 CR3 W* W*
* CR1-CR3 are only writable in soft mode.
